WIRING 

 

WARNING

: RISK OF ELECTRICAL SHOCK OR ELECTROCUTION. 

This water 

garden pump must be installed by a licensed or certified electrician or a qualified water garden 

serviceman in accordance with the National Electrical Code and all applicable local codes and 

ordinances. Improper installation will create an electrical hazard which could result in death or 

damage to property. Always disconnect power to the water garden pump at the circuit breaker 

before servicing the pump. Failure to do so could result in death or serious injury to serviceman, 

water garden users or others due to electric shock.

 

 

1.

 

Make sure all electrical breakers and switches are turned off before wiring motor. 

2.

 

Make sure that the wiring voltage matches the motor voltage (230v or 115v). If they do not 

match the motor will burn up. 

3.

 

Choose the correct wire size. When in doubt use a heavier gauge (larger diameter) wire. 

Heavier gauge will allow the motor to run cooler and more efficient. 

4.

 

Cut wires to the appropriate length so they don’t overlap or touch when connected to the 

terminal board. 

5.

 

Make sure all electrical connections are clean and tight. 

6.

 

Permanently ground the motor using the internal, green ground terminal located on the 
inside of the motor canopy or access plate. Use the correct wire size and type specified by 

National Electrical Code. Make sure the ground wire is connected to an electrical service 
ground. 

7.

 

Bond the motor to the water garden structure in accordance with the National Electrical 
Code. Use a solid No. 8 AWG or larger copper conductor. Run a wire from the brass 

external bonding clamp to the water garden bonding structure. 

8.

 

Connect the pump permanently to a circuit. Make sure no other lights or appliances are on 

the same circuit. 

 

NOTE

: If the pump is installed below the water level of the water garden, close 

return and suction lines prior to opening hair and lint pot on pump. Make sure to re-

open valves prior to operating.
